A STUDY of possible economic advantages to the aircraft operator of utilizing the internal cooling potentialities of water to assist aircraft-engine cooling and increase detonation limited powers is presented here.Cost analysis is made of three methods of increasing airplane performance by water injection, namely: It is concluded by the author that if the water to be used for cooling does not displace an equivalent weight of payload, a maximum saving of 7% at sea level and 18% at 25,000 ft can be realized in direct operating cost with water. At the same operating cost a performance increase of 3% at sea level and 12% at 25,000 ft can be realized. However, if the water carried results in an equivalent loss in payload, the operating cost may be doubled if water injection is used.
